Study: Even Moderate Drinking Damages the Brain and Increases Dementia Risk

For decades, public health officials have debated whether moderate alcohol consumption is harmless or even beneficial. But a groundbreaking new study confirms what skeptics have long suspected: No amount of alcohol is safe for the brain.

In a paper published in Neurology, researchers from the University of Sao Paulo Medical School found that even seven drinks per week – long considered “moderate” drinking – significantly raises the risk of brain lesions linked to dementia. Heavy drinkers face even starker consequences, dying an average of 13 years earlier than abstainers.

The study examined brain tissue from autopsies of 1,781 individuals, averaging 75 years old at death. Researchers identified two key markers of brain damage: tau tangles (abnormal protein clumps tied to Alzheimer’s) and hyaline arteriolosclerosis (a hardening of small blood vessels that restricts blood flow, leading to brain lesions.)

Heavy drinkers (eight or more drinks weekly) were 133 percent more likely to have these lesions than nondrinkers. Even moderate drinkers (seven or fewer drinks) faced 60 percent higher odds, challenging the myth that light drinking is harmless. (Related: Moderate Alcohol Consumption Shrinks Brain.)

“Drink moderately” no longer safe

The study’s threshold for “heavy drinking” – eight drinks weekly – is conservative. U.S. guidelines define it as more than 15 drinks per week for men, and surveys show the top 10 percent of American drinkers consume 74 drinks weekly — over 10 per day. “The real-world risk is likely higher,” noted Dr. Mollie Monnig of Brown University, who was not involved in the study.

Alcohol consumption has been culturally ingrained in humans, from medieval Europe’s beer-as-sustenance to the 1990s push for red wine’s heart benefits. But modern science has dismantled these myths. Earlier this year, former U.S. Surgeon General Vivek Murthy called for alcohol warning labels, citing its role as the third-leading preventable cause of cancer.

The study underscores that reducing alcohol intake lowers risk. Experts recommend the following methods to cut down on booze:

  • Tracking daily consumption
  • Taking breaks to assess alcohol’s impact
  • Alternating alcoholic and nonalcoholic drinks
  • Recognizing signs of dependency, like failed attempts to cut back
